Under this heading one or more of the following values can appear:
A schedule resolved between January 1 and June 30 has a January (JAN) schedule, and one resolved between July 1 and December 31 has a July (JUL) schedule.
The schedule is suspended from execution until it is reset by an NXTCYC=ON command.
The next execution of this scheduled job is skipped, but subsequent cycles are scheduled.
The schedule member has been updated through the SCHDMOD panel.
The schedule member received a modification through the DB.2.7 panel, and a top line RESOLV command was issued that caused the schedule to revert to the original schedule information.
The schedule will begin in the month mmm (JAN or JUL) of the year yy.
The schedule needs to be re-resolved because it has been over a year since the last RESOLV.
The schedule has been changed through the DB.2.1-E panel and saved to the database but not resolved.

Under this heading one or more of the following values can appear:
A schedule RESOLVed between January 1 and June 30 has a January (JAN) schedule, and one RESOLVed between July 1 and December 31 has a July (JUL) schedule.
Indicates the schedule member has been updated through the DB.2.7 panel.
Indicates that the schedule member received a modification through the DB.2.7 panel, and a top line RESOLV command was issued that caused the schedule to revert to the original schedule information.
Indicates that the schedule begins in the month mmm (JAN or JUL) of the year yy.
Indicates that the schedule has been changed through the DB.2.1-E panel and saved to the database but not RESOLVed.
Indicates that the schedule needs to be re-RESOLVed because it has been over a year since the last RESOLV.
